Position Summary
Serves as Facility Maintenance Specialist for the Chevy Chase Country Club and occasionally Community Recreation Center, Chamber Community Church, Heritage Park Sports Complex, and Family Aquatic Center. Responsibilities include conducting the maintenance, custodial, and room setups/teardowns of the facilities. Ensures that all support and service is conducted and fulfilled in a manner consistent with the goals and objectives of the Wheeling Park District. Work schedule will be Saturday-Wednesday 5:00am - 1:00pm.
Essential Job Duties
- Conducts and supervises facility maintenance and custodial functions in conjunction with Facility Maintenance Manager and Facility Maintenance Leaders.
- Custodial tasks include, but are not limited to cleaning floors (vinyl and carpet and wood), windows, lavatories, shower/locker facilities, windows; emptying trash; dusting furniture; and arranging for occasional contract cleaning services; e.g., draperies. In outdoor areas, emptying of trash receptacles, cleaning of water fountains and cleaning of outdoor furniture, snow shoveling and/or cleaning walks.
- Handles all minor maintenance and troubleshooting including lighting, ceiling panels, office equipment and general facility needs.
- Provides all set-up/tear-down requirements for the use of all general use areas, to include tables, chairs, audio-visual equipment and sound equipment.
- Understands technology and completes required checklists and inspections in City Reporter and record their jobs tasks in the Harvest Software.
- Supervises and assists in training part time staff.
- Assists in the development and maintenance of the short-term and long-term requirements for repair and maintenance, preventative maintenance, capital replacement and capital requirements.
- Responds to all emergencies and alarms when on duty or otherwise in an on-call status.
- Ensures that sufficient custodial supplies and materials are always available and specifies cleaning supplies needed in order to accomplish work tasks safely and adequately.
- Provides grounds maintenance to include sidewalks, curbs and parking lots.
- Assist in maintaining infrastructure integrity of the Community Recreation Center, Chevy Chase Country Club, Chamber Community Church, Heritage Park Sports Complex, and Family Aquatic Center facilities.
- Informs the Facility Maintenance Manager and/or Maintenance Leaders of problems related to work or change in project plans as prescribed.
Qualifications
Position Requirements
High School graduate. A minimum of one (1) year experience in a related field of custodial, property and facility maintenance and repairs or any equivalent combination of education, experience and training which provides the required knowledge, skills and abilities.
